Choosing the best possible elementary school is critical to a child’s foundational development. In Texas, public school districts adopt curriculum standards set by the State Board of Education. The current standards, called Texas Essential Knowledge and Skills, outline what students should be able to learn and do in each course or grade. The curriculum is structured around the fundamentals of mathematics, science, social studies, language arts, music and reading.
We are making this task easier for you by comparing two above average elementary schools: Neff Ecc and Gallegos Elementary School. We compiled relevant data for you to be able to make an informed decision. Both schools are under the jurisdiction of the HOUSTON ISD.
Neff Ecc has a regular student population of 570 with a 16.7 students/teacher ratio while Gallegos Elementary School has 333 students and a student-teacher ratio of 15.3 students/teacher ratio.
Neff Ecc earned a State accountability rating of B (80-89). It scored 87 overall in post-secondary readiness, a broad term that refers to student preparedness to undertake multiple pathways after graduation, or specifically, their preparedness for college education only.
On the other hand, Gallegos Elementary School also earned a State accountability rating of B. The school posted 71 in student achievement, 92 in school progress, 83 in closing performance gaps and 89 overall in post-secondary readiness.
A distinction designation acknowledges districts and campuses for outstanding achievement based on the outcomes of several performance indicators. Distinction designations are awarded for achievement in several areas and are based on performance relative to a group of campuses of similar type, size, grade span, and student demographics.
Distinction Designations for Neff Ecc and Gallegos Elementary School are not applicable as neither one earned a recognition for outstanding achievement in seven categories.
Based on Racial/Ethnic Groups, the dominant group in Neff Ecc is Hispanics who make up nearly 86.84% of student population, followed by African Americans (7.54%), Asians (3.33%), Whites or Caucasians (1.93%), Native Americans (0.18%) and Two or More Races (0.18%).
At Gallegos Elementary School, Hispanics make up 97.00% of student population, followed by African Americans (2.70%) and Whites or Caucasians (0.30%). There is no Asians, Native Americans and Two or More Racesstudents in the school.
Based on household incomes, the Neff Ecc’s economically disadvantaged students is lower at 95.79% compared to 97.90% at Gallegos Elementary School.
In terms of Limited English Proficiency (LEP), a term used in the United States that refers to a person who is not fluent in the English Language, mainly because it is not their native language, Neff Ecc has a significantly higher number of English Language Learners comprising 79.30% of its student population compared to 49.55% at Gallegos Elementary School.
In addition, Neff Ecc has 79.30% bilingual students, 1.05% are in the gifted and talented program, while 3.51% are in the special education program. This stacks up against Gallegos Elementary School with 45.65% bilingual students, 7.81% gifted and talented students and 13.51% students in the special education program.
34 teachers employed at Neff Ecc have been teaching in the school for an average of about 7.9 years with individual teaching experience averaging 10.2 years. The 21 teachers at Gallegos Elementary School have been serving the school for an average of 5 years with individual teaching experience averaging 7.9 years.
Of its teaching staff, Neff Ecc no teacher serving the school for over 30 years, has two teachers serving the school for 20-30 years, 16 teachers have worked for 11-20 years, five teachers have worked for 6-10 years, while 11 teachers have been serving the school for over 1-5 years, and school has no beginning teacher. Gallegos Elementary School no teacher serving the school for over 30 years, has four teachers serving the school for 20-30 years, two teachers have worked for 11-20 years, three teachers have worked for 6-10 years, while eight teachers have been serving the school for over 1-5 years, including five beginning teachers.
In both schools, female teachers outnumber the male teachers. At Neff Ecc there are 32 female teachers and two male teachers. Of its teaching staff, one special education teacher is being assisted by two teachers aides or paraprofessionals. In addition to its teaching staff, the school has one staff members in the school administration department and three more working as school support staff.
At Gallegos Elementary School there are 18 female teachers and three male teachers. Of its teaching staff, two special education teachers are being assisted by four teachers aides or paraprofessionals. In addition to its teaching staff, the school has zero staff members in the school administration department and three more working as school support staff.
